400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el表格文字为什么不能随意换行

作者:路由通
|
255人看过
发布时间:2026-04-16 16:52:41
标签:
在Excel表格中,文字换行并非简单的文本编辑操作,而是涉及单元格格式、数据结构和软件底层逻辑的复杂功能。随意换行可能导致数据对齐错乱、公式引用失效、打印格式异常以及文件兼容性问题。理解其限制背后的技术原理与设计考量,能帮助我们更专业地处理表格数据,避免常见操作误区,提升工作效率与数据管理的规范性。
excel表格文字为什么不能随意换行

       在日常使用Excel处理数据时,许多用户都曾遇到过这样的困惑:为什么单元格里的文字不能像在Word文档中那样随心所欲地换行?有时我们调整列宽,文字会自动折行;有时即便使用了“自动换行”功能,排版效果仍不尽如人意;更不用说那些因为随意换行而引发的公式错误、打印混乱等后续问题。实际上,Excel中的文字换行并非一个孤立的文本编辑功能,而是与表格的底层数据结构、计算逻辑、显示引擎及文件格式紧密相连的复杂机制。本文将深入剖析Excel表格文字不能随意换行的多重原因,从技术原理到实际应用,为您揭示其背后的设计逻辑与最佳实践。

       一、单元格的本质是数据容器,而非文本编辑器

       首先需要明确的是,Excel的核心定位是电子表格软件,其主要功能是处理数值计算、数据分析和关系建模。每个单元格首先被视为一个独立的数据单元,其设计优先考虑的是数据的存储、引用与计算效率。与专注于版面排版的文字处理软件不同,Excel的单元格在默认状态下并不以多行文本的自然流动为目标。当我们在单元格中输入较长文字时,软件会优先尝试在单行内完整显示,若列宽不足,则显示为截断状态或延伸到右侧空白单元格。这种设计保证了在浏览大量数据时,用户能快速横向扫描同一行的不同字段,维持数据表的视觉结构化特性。

       二、自动换行功能受限于列宽与行高的刚性约束

       Excel提供了“自动换行”功能,但这并非真正意义上的自由文本换行。该功能严格依赖于当前单元格的列宽:文字会根据列宽在单词或字符边界处折行,且行高会自动调整以容纳全部内容。然而,列宽与行高在Excel中均有最小与最大限制值,列宽以标准字符数为单位,行高以磅值为单位。一旦文字长度超出列宽可容纳的折行后的最小行高极限,内容仍会被部分隐藏或显示为“”。这意味着换行行为始终被限制在预设的二维网格体系内,无法像流动文本那样动态扩展版面。

       三、手动强制换行破坏数据结构的完整性

       通过快捷键“Alt+Enter”可以在单元格内插入手动换行符,实现精确位置的换行。但这种操作实际上在单元格文本值中嵌入了不可见的控制字符(换行符)。当这类数据被导入其他系统、用于文本解析或参与公式运算时,换行符可能被视为特殊分隔符,导致数据拆分错误。例如,使用“分列”功能时若未指定换行符为分隔符,则可能将单单元格内容误判为多行;在查找替换、字符串函数处理时,换行符也需要特殊处理,否则易引发计算异常。

       四、公式引用与计算依赖单元格地址的稳定性

       Excel的威力很大程度上来自于其公式计算引擎。公式中通过单元格地址(如A1、B2)引用数据,这些地址对应的是网格中固定位置。如果允许文字像自由文本那样随意换行并动态影响单元格的物理尺寸与位置,将导致单元格的视觉边界与逻辑地址之间的关系变得模糊。例如,假设一个长文本通过换行占用了下方单元格的空间,那么下方单元格的地址是否应该顺延?其原本存储的数据又该置于何处?这种不确定性会彻底破坏公式引用的可靠性,使得求和、引用、查找等基础功能无法正常工作。

       五、排序与筛选功能要求数据行保持独立

       排序和筛选是数据管理的核心操作。Excel在执行这些操作时,以“行”为基本单位进行整体移动或显示隐藏。每一行数据被视为一条独立记录。如果允许文字随意换行并侵入其他行,会导致行与行之间的界限消失。例如,若A单元格的文字换行后占用了B单元格的部分空间,那么对第1行排序时,是否应该连同B单元格的部分内容一起移动?这会造成数据关联的混乱,破坏数据集的完整性,使得排序结果不可预测,筛选条件无法准确应用。

       六、打印与页面布局依赖精确的单元格定位

       当需要打印Excel表格或设置页面布局时,软件会将工作表网格映射到物理纸张上。分页符的位置、页眉页脚、打印区域等都基于单元格的行列坐标计算。如果单元格内文字换行行为过于随意,导致行高动态变化过大,可能会使原本规划好的内容意外跨页,打乱表格的连贯性。打印预览中常见的“内容被截断”或“空白页”问题,很多时候正是由于未受控的换行导致行高扩张,破坏了预设的页面分割逻辑。

       七、合并单元格加剧了换行控制的复杂性

       合并单元格是另一种常见的排版操作,它将多个单元格合并为一个大的单元格。在合并后的单元格中使用自动换行或手动换行,其行为更加难以预测。因为合并单元格的“列宽”实际上是原始多列宽度的总和,但换行计算时可能不会均匀利用所有空间。此外,合并单元格会严重影响数据的结构化,使其无法参与排序、筛选以及部分数据透视表操作。在合并单元格内随意换行,往往会使数据呈现更加混乱,且后续取消合并时,文本内容可能全部堆积于左上角单元格,造成数据丢失或错位。

       八、数据导入导出与跨平台兼容性风险

       Excel数据经常需要与其他系统交换,如导入数据库、导出为CSV(逗号分隔值)文件或与其他办公软件协作。在CSV等纯文本格式中,换行符通常被用作记录分隔符(即一行数据的结束)。如果单元格内包含手动换行符,那么在导出为CSV时,一个单元格内的内容可能会被错误解析为多条记录,导致数据文件结构损坏。同样,从外部文本文件导入数据时,如果源文件中的换行符处理不当,也可能导致数据被错误地拆分到多个单元格中。

       九、字体、字号与缩放显示的影响

       单元格内文字的显示效果不仅取决于字符数,还与字体、字号以及窗口缩放比例密切相关。同样的文字,在宋体与微软雅黑下,其宽度可能不同;调整显示缩放比例,也会改变屏幕上字符的渲染尺寸,从而影响自动换行的实际断行位置。这意味着,在一台电脑上排版完美的换行文本,在另一台使用不同默认字体或显示设置的电脑上打开时,可能会出现意料之外的换行或溢出,影响表格的可读性与专业性。

       十、数据验证与条件格式的规则依赖单元格边界

       数据验证用于限制单元格输入内容,条件格式则根据规则改变单元格外观。这两项功能的工作范围都是针对单个单元格或规则定义的单元格区域。如果文字通过换行实质性地影响了单元格的视觉范围或逻辑内容,可能会干扰数据验证规则的触发条件,或使条件格式的视觉提示(如颜色填充)应用到不准确的范围。例如,一个根据文本长度设置的条件格式,可能因为换行符的存在而误判文本的实际长度。

       十一、图表与图形对象的数据源关联

       创建图表时,数据源通常来自连续的单元格区域。图表的数据系列、轴标签等元素与这些单元格地址紧密绑定。如果因为单元格内文字换行导致行高变化,进而可能影响到图表数据源区域的实际范围(尽管地址未变,但视觉上可能被误读),虽然不会直接改变引用,但会增加用户理解数据源时的困惑。此外,如果单元格文本作为图表标题或数据标签被链接,其中的换行符可能会破坏标签的美观布局。

       十二、宏与脚本编程的稳定性要求

       对于使用VBA(Visual Basic for Applications,可视化基础应用程序)或其它脚本进行自动化操作的高级用户,他们编写的代码往往假设单元格的内容是相对规整的。代码可能通过计算字符串长度、查找特定字符位置等方式处理文本。单元格内不可预测的换行符会成为代码中的“地雷”,导致字符串处理函数返回意外结果,循环遍历单元格时出现逻辑错误,从而使得自动化任务失败或产生错误输出。

       十三、协作编辑中的版本一致性问题

       在多人协同编辑一份Excel文档时,保持视图一致性至关重要。如果换行行为过度依赖本地环境的字体设置或列宽,那么不同协作者看到的表格布局可能差异巨大。某人调整了某列宽度以获得更好的换行效果,却可能无意中破坏了其他人精心设计的其他列的对齐。这种不可控的格式变动会增加沟通成本,降低协作效率,甚至引发数据误解。

       十四、性能考量与大规模数据处理的效率

       Excel需要处理可能包含数十万甚至上百万行数据的工作表。如果每个单元格都允许复杂、自由的文本换行和流动排版,软件需要实时计算每个单元格的文本布局、行高调整以及全局的视觉重排,这将给计算资源和渲染性能带来巨大负担,导致滚动卡顿、计算缓慢。当前的受限换行模式,是在功能灵活性与处理性能之间做出的重要平衡。

       十五、面向数据库思维的结构化数据规范

       从数据管理的更高层面看,Excel常常作为小型数据库或数据预处理工具使用。规范的结构化数据要求每个字段(列)下的数据具有相同的类型和格式,每条记录(行)保持独立。一个单元格内包含多行文本,相当于在一个字段里塞入了非结构化的段落信息,这违反了数据库设计的“原子性”原则(即每个单元格应只包含一个数据项),会给后续的数据分析、挖掘和转换带来不必要的麻烦。

       十六、辅助功能与屏幕阅读器的兼容性

       为视障用户服务的屏幕阅读器软件,在读取表格内容时,通常按行或按单元格的顺序进行。如果单元格内存在多个手动换行,屏幕阅读器可能会将其读作多个独立的“句子”或“段落”,破坏了数据的上下文连贯性,导致理解困难。规范、简洁的单元格内容更有利于辅助技术准确传达信息。

       十七、历史沿袭与用户习惯的继承

       Excel的设计哲学源于早期的电子表格软件,其网格化、计算导向的界面已深入人心,形成了强大的用户习惯和行业惯例。彻底改变其文本处理方式,转向自由排版,不仅涉及底层架构的重构,也会颠覆全球数亿用户的操作习惯,学习成本与迁移风险极高。因此,其文本换行功能是在原有框架内的有限增强,而非根本性变革。

       十八、替代方案与最佳实践建议

       理解了上述限制,我们便能采取更专业的策略:对于长文本说明,建议使用“批注”或“备注”功能;对于必须放在单元格内的多行文本,应合理设置固定列宽,并谨慎使用“自动换行”,避免过度依赖手动换行符;在涉及数据交换的场景,提前清理单元格内的换行符;当文字量极大时,应考虑将描述性文字放入Word文档,而在Excel中仅保留关键数据字段,并通过超链接进行关联。核心原则是:让Excel专注于它擅长的结构化数据计算与管理,将复杂的段落排版交给更合适的工具。

       综上所述,Excel表格中文字不能随意换行,是软件核心设计理念、技术架构约束、数据完整性要求、性能考量与用户体验等多方面因素共同作用的结果。它并非一个功能缺陷,而是一种权衡下的设计选择。作为用户,深入理解这些背后的逻辑,不仅能帮助我们避免操作误区,更能引导我们以更规范、更高效的方式运用Excel这一强大工具,从而在数据处理与分析工作中达到事半功倍的效果。

相关文章
减速机速比怎么计算
减速机速比的计算是机械传动系统设计与选型的核心环节,它直接关系到设备的输出扭矩、转速以及整体运行效率。本文将系统性地阐述速比的定义与物理意义,深入剖析其计算公式与推导逻辑,涵盖常见减速机类型如齿轮、蜗轮蜗杆、行星齿轮等的速比计算方法。同时,文章将结合工程实践,探讨速比选择对负载匹配、效率及设备寿命的影响,并提供清晰的计算实例与选型指导,旨在为工程师和技术人员提供一份全面、实用且具备专业深度的参考指南。
2026-04-16 16:52:37
216人看过
excel为什么一移就到最后
在使用微软电子表格软件处理数据时,许多用户都曾遭遇过这样的困扰:鼠标或键盘的轻微移动,光标便瞬间跳转至工作表的最底部或最右侧,打断了原本流畅的操作。这一现象并非软件故障,其背后涉及多种操作习惯、软件设置以及数据本身的特点。本文将深入剖析光标异常跳转的十二个核心原因,从滚动锁定、数据区域定义到系统资源占用,并提供一系列行之有效的解决方案,帮助用户从根本上掌握控制光标的方法,提升数据处理效率。
2026-04-16 16:52:05
319人看过
若依使用的是什么excel依赖
若依开源框架在数据处理与导出功能上表现卓越,其核心能力离不开对特定表格处理库的深度集成。本文将深入剖析若依框架所采用的表格处理依赖库,不仅会明确指出其名称与版本选择,更会系统阐述该库的技术特性、在若依中的具体应用场景、配置与优化方法,以及与其他方案的对比。文章旨在为开发者提供一份从理论到实践的完整指南,帮助大家高效、稳定地实现企业级数据导出需求。
2026-04-16 16:51:35
314人看过
excel正版与盗版有什么区别
在数字化办公领域,微软表格处理软件(Microsoft Excel)的正版与盗版版本之间存在本质区别。本文将从法律合规、功能完整性、安全性、技术支持、更新服务、数据稳定性、云服务集成、商业风险、长期成本、隐私保护、功能创新、法律后果、用户体验、社会责任、软件生态及未来发展等十多个核心维度,进行深度剖析与对比,为您揭示选择正版软件的全面价值与长远利益。
2026-04-16 16:50:36
362人看过
为什么word打开后是小窗口
在使用微软的Word文字处理软件时,不少用户都曾遇到过文档启动后显示为小窗口的情况。这并非简单的软件故障,其背后往往与系统设置、软件自身状态以及用户的操作习惯紧密相关。本文将深入剖析导致这一现象的十二个核心原因,从窗口状态记忆、多显示器配置到模板文件影响,提供一系列经过验证的解决方案,帮助您彻底理解并掌控Word的窗口行为,提升办公效率。
2026-04-16 16:50:24
347人看过
为什么现在免费word不能用了
随着办公软件生态的演变,过去随处可见的免费微软Word(Microsoft Word)正逐渐淡出大众视野。这背后是软件商业模式从一次性买断向云端订阅的根本性转变,以及知识产权保护、安全合规与技术架构升级等多重因素的共同作用。本文将深入剖析这一现象背后的十二个核心驱动因素,从微软的官方策略到用户的实际需求,揭示免费午餐终结的必然逻辑。
2026-04-16 16:50:05
312人看过